How To Choose The Best 5 Cup Coffee Maker With Auto Shut Off

Selecting a small drip coffee maker with auto shut-off involves more than looking for the words “auto shut-off” on the box. The shut-off timer’s duration, how it interacts with the keep-warm plate, and whether the machine also includes dry-boil protection all affect your day-to-day safety and convenience.

Shut-Off Timer Duration

Most machines in this size class default to a two-hour auto shut-off after the brew cycle ends. A few programmable models let you adjust the timer or bypass it entirely on the keep-warm plate. If you tend to pour coffee and leave immediately for work, a shorter shut-off window (or one that kicks in after brewing stops) gives you more peace of mind.

Pause-and-Serve vs. Shut-Off Logic

The pause-and-serve feature — which lets you grab a cup mid-brew — temporarily halts the drip cycle. Some machines treat this pause as part of the brewing time, which can shorten the effective keep-warm window. High-end models separate the two timers so your shut-off doesn’t reset just because you grabbed an early cup.

Dry-Boil Protection

Dry-boil protection is a secondary safety layer that turns the heating element off when the water tank runs dry. This matters more on a 5-cup machine than on a larger unit because the smaller tank empties faster if you’re brewing multiple pots back-to-back. Machines that include both auto shut-off and dry-boil protection give you a true fail-safe pair.

1. Kismile 5-Cup Drip Coffee Machine

0.75L tankDishwasher-safe funnel

The Kismile packs a rare combination for this price tier: an LED display, a 12-hour programmable timer, and a two-hour auto shut-off with dry-boil protection. The 0.75-liter tank brews five standard cups, and the detachable funnel and glass carafe are both dishwasher-safe — a cleaning advantage over many similarly priced rivals.

Buyers consistently report that the carafe rinses clean without staining or leaving residue, and the filtering system produces a clear cup with no granules. The 30-second anti-drip mechanism prevents countertop spills when you grab a cup mid-cycle. Users also praise the front-panel clock and the intuitive program buttons, which make setting the brew schedule straightforward.

The main trade-off is the plastic housing, which feels lighter than stainless-steel alternatives. A few users note that the permanent screen basket can let fine grounds through unless you add a paper cone filter. Overall, the Kismile delivers high-end programmability at a mid-range price point, making it the most versatile pick for the average home or office user.

FAQ

How long does the auto shut-off last on a 5 cup coffee maker?
Most models in this category shut off after 2 hours of operation on the keep-warm plate. Some programmable units let you set a shorter or longer window, but 120 minutes is the industry standard for compact drip machines. Always check the product manual since the timer starts from the end of the brew cycle, not from the moment you turn the machine on.
Can I use a paper filter with a reusable filter basket?
Yes. Many owners place a #2 cone paper filter inside the reusable basket to catch fine grounds that slip through the mesh. This does not interfere with the auto shut-off or pause-and-serve features. It adds a small ongoing cost but produces a noticeably cleaner cup of coffee, especially with finer ground roasts.
Does the pause-and-serve feature affect the auto shut-off timer?
It depends on the machine. On basic models, the 30-second pause is counted as part of the overall brewing time, which can shorten the keep-warm window if you pause multiple times. Higher-end machines run independent timers so that pausing mid-brew does not reset or reduce the shut-off countdown. Review the manual to understand how your specific model handles this timing interaction.
